QPython 是一款基于 Python 的跨平台开发工具,专为快速开发和调试而设计,具有图形化界面、代码编辑、调试、运行等功能。其核心优势在于提供了一种直观的开发方式,使开发者能够更高效地进行编程实践。QPython 适用于多种开发场景,包括但不限于应用程序开发、数据处理、自动化脚本编写等。
随着 Python 的广泛应用,QPython 逐渐成为开发者的重要工具之一。本文将详细阐述 QPython 手机的使用方法,涵盖安装、界面操作、功能模块、开发流程、调试技巧以及常见问题解决等方面,为用户全面了解 QPython 手机的使用提供指导。 QPython 手机的使用概述 QPython 手机是一款面向移动用户的 Python 开发工具,它通过图形化界面和简洁的操作方式,让用户能够轻松地进行编程和调试。QPython 手机不仅支持 Python 3.x 的语法,还提供了丰富的开发工具和调试功能,使得开发者能够在手机上进行高效的开发工作。QPython 手机的使用方式与传统的桌面开发工具类似,但其界面设计更加直观,操作更加便捷,适合不同层次的开发者使用。 QPython 手机的安装与配置 1.下载与安装 QPython 手机可以通过官方渠道下载,通常在应用商店或官方网站上提供。安装过程通常包括以下几个步骤: - 打开应用商店或官网,搜索“QPython”; - 点击“安装”按钮,等待下载完成; - 安装完成后,打开应用,进入主界面。 2.配置开发环境 安装完成后,需要进行一些基本的配置,以确保 QPython 手机能够正常运行。 - 选择开发环境,通常包括 Python 解释器、库文件、运行环境等; - 设置项目路径,以便后续开发时能够方便地管理项目; - 配置调试工具,如断点、变量监视等,以提高开发效率。 3.启动开发环境 完成配置后,点击“启动”按钮,QPython 手机将进入开发模式。此时,用户可以开始编写代码,进行调试和运行。 QPython 手机的界面操作 QPython 手机的界面设计简洁直观,主要包括以下几个部分: 1.编辑区 编辑区是用户编写和修改代码的主要区域。用户可以在此输入 Python 代码,并进行编辑。编辑区支持代码高亮、语法提示、代码折叠等功能,有助于提高开发效率。 2.调试区 调试区用于运行和调试代码。用户可以点击“运行”按钮,运行代码并查看输出结果。调试区还支持断点设置、变量监视、堆栈跟踪等功能,帮助用户更深入地理解代码执行过程。 3.输出区 输出区用于显示代码运行结果,包括控制台输出、日志信息等。用户可以通过输出区查看程序的运行状态,及时发现问题。 4.工具栏 工具栏包含多个功能按钮,如“新建文件”、“保存文件”、“运行代码”、“调试”、“帮助”等,方便用户进行常用操作。 QPython 手机的功能模块 QPython 手机提供了丰富的功能模块,以满足不同开发需求。
下面呢是其主要功能模块的详细介绍: 1.代码编辑与管理 QPython 手机支持多种编程语言,包括 Python、Java、C++ 等。用户可以通过代码编辑器编写、保存、编译和运行代码。
除了这些以外呢,还支持版本控制功能,用户可以管理代码版本,方便协作开发。 2.调试与测试 调试功能是 QPython 手机的核心功能之一。用户可以设置断点、查看变量值、监视内存使用情况等。调试工具还支持断点调试、单步执行、回溯等功能,帮助用户快速定位和解决问题。 3.运行与执行 QPython 手机支持多种运行模式,包括单机运行、远程运行、网络调试等。用户可以根据需要选择适合的运行方式,确保代码能够顺利执行。 4.项目管理 QPython 手机提供了项目管理功能,用户可以创建、组织、管理多个项目。项目管理支持版本控制、依赖管理、构建配置等功能,提高开发效率。 5.插件与扩展 QPython 手机支持插件系统,用户可以安装和使用第三方插件,扩展其功能。插件包括代码分析、性能优化、调试工具等,满足不同开发需求。 QPython 手机的开发流程 QPython 手机的开发流程通常包括以下几个步骤: 1.需求分析 在开始开发之前,用户需要明确开发需求,包括功能需求、性能需求、界面需求等。需求分析是开发工作的基础,确保开发方向正确。 2.设计与规划 根据需求分析结果,用户需要设计系统架构、模块划分、数据库设计等。设计阶段需要考虑系统的可扩展性、可维护性以及性能优化。 3.编码与开发 用户在 QPython 手机中编写代码,进行模块开发。编码过程中,用户可以利用 QPython 提供的工具和库,提高开发效率。 4.测试与调试 开发完成后,用户需要进行测试,包括单元测试、集成测试、功能测试等。测试过程中,用户可以使用 QPython 提供的调试工具,快速定位和解决问题。 5.部署与发布 测试通过后,用户将代码部署到目标平台,进行发布。部署方式包括本地运行、服务器部署、云平台部署等。 QPython 手机的调试技巧 调试是软件开发中不可或缺的一环,QPython 手机提供了多种调试技巧,帮助用户高效地进行调试工作: 1.断点调试 断点调试是调试的核心技巧之一。用户可以在代码中设置断点,当程序执行到该断点时,会自动暂停,便于查看变量值、执行流程等。 2.变量监视 变量监视功能可以帮助用户实时查看变量的值,了解程序运行状态。用户可以通过变量监视查看变量的变化,及时发现错误。 3.单步执行 单步执行功能允许用户逐步执行代码,观察每一步的执行结果。这有助于用户理解程序执行流程,发现潜在问题。 4.日志输出 QPython 手机支持日志输出功能,用户可以在代码中添加日志语句,记录程序运行过程中的关键信息。日志可以帮助用户快速定位问题。 5.性能分析 性能分析功能可以帮助用户了解程序运行效率,优化代码性能。用户可以通过性能分析工具,查看程序的执行时间、内存使用情况等。 常见问题及解决方法 在使用 QPython 手机的过程中,用户可能会遇到一些问题,以下是一些常见问题及解决方法: 1.代码无法运行 问题原因可能是代码语法错误、环境配置不正确、依赖库缺失等。解决方法包括检查代码语法、确保环境配置正确、安装缺失的依赖库。 2.调试无法启动 问题原因可能是调试工具未正确配置、代码未正确编译等。解决方法包括重新配置调试工具、检查代码是否正确编译。 3.运行速度慢 问题原因可能是代码效率低、资源占用高、未进行优化等。解决方法包括优化代码逻辑、使用更高效的算法、合理管理内存。 4.界面显示异常 问题原因可能是界面配置错误、资源文件缺失等。解决方法包括重新配置界面、检查资源文件是否完整。 QPython 手机的在以后发展趋势 随着移动开发技术的不断发展,QPython 手机也在不断进化。在以后,QPython 手机可能会引入更多智能化功能,如人工智能辅助开发、跨平台开发支持、云服务集成等。
除了这些以外呢,随着 Python 的广泛应用,QPython 手机将更加注重用户体验,提供更高效的开发工具和更直观的界面设计。 归结起来说 QPython 手机作为一款基于 Python 的跨平台开发工具,具有图形化界面、代码编辑、调试、运行等功能,能够满足不同层次的开发者需求。通过合理的安装配置、界面操作、功能模块使用以及调试技巧的掌握,用户可以高效地进行开发工作。
于此同时呢,QPython 手机的在以后发展也充满潜力,将继续推动移动开发的发展。掌握 QPython 手机的使用方法,不仅能够提升开发效率,还能帮助用户更好地应对复杂的开发需求。